The Children's Society has been helping children and young people in this country for over 140 years. We run local services that support children when they are at their most vulnerable and in desperate need of help. We're there for children, every step of the way.

This role sits within our National Mobilisation Knowledge Group, which seeks to attract new supporters to The Children's Society through paid advertising channels as part of our integrated campaign planning.

WHAT WE'RE LOOKING FOR

We are currently looking for an experienced paid campaign manager to join our dynamic, ambitious team.

A key part of this role will be your ability to design and deliver paid digital campaign strategies and work with media agencies to ensure our investment is reaping rewards. You will enjoy working on a test and learn basis, trying out new products and channels, and upscaling successful activities to deliver on our targets.

KEY SKILLS AND COMPETENCIES

In order to be successful in this role, you must have:

-Significant experience in managing digital paid media campaigns, including on Meta and Google

-Experience in working with media agencies to deliver integrated marketing campaigns

-The ability to report on campaign progress within delivery teams and to senior stakeholders, and to advise on when to pivot tactics

-Ideally, line management experience to help develop and coach the Digital Marketing Officer

INFO ABOUT THE CHILDREN'S SOCIETY

The Children's Society runs over 100 local services that help thousands of young people who desperately need our support, and we campaign to get laws and policies changed to make children's lives happier and safer.

Every day we're changing the lives of children in this country for the better - and with your help, tomorrow we can be there for even more.

The Children's Society is committed to safeguarding and protecting the children and young people that we work with. As such, all posts are subject to a safer recruitment process, including the disclosure of criminal records and vetting checks. We ensure that we have a range of policies and procedures in place which promote safeguarding and safer working practices across our services.
